Kondo Dental Clinic (Medical Corporation Chosai-kai), located in the Okubo area of Shinjuku Ward, is a dental clinic that opened in 1981 in a convenient location just a 2-minute walk from JR Okubo Station North Exit and 6 minutes from Shin-Okubo Station. Operating under the philosophy that 'the mouth is the entrance to both the digestive and respiratory systems,' the clinic provides treatment that goes beyond simple dental care to address overall health. The clinic places particular emphasis on halitosis treatment and occlusal treatment, carefully identifying the causes of bad breath and working toward improvement, while also actively addressing vague symptoms such as shoulder stiffness and headaches caused by bite misalignment. Periodontal disease care is also comprehensive, with the clinic focusing on prevention and treatment based on the understanding that periodontal disease is a primary cause of tooth loss. In terms of hygiene management, the clinic has implemented the 'Epios Eco System' to generate hypochlorous acid water, maintaining a clean environment throughout the facility. The clinic is also registered as a 'GBT Certified Clinic,' meeting standards set by the Swiss company EMS, and practices advanced approaches to cavity and periodontal disease prevention. A specialized treatment space called 'Excellent Breath Kondo' with completely private rooms is located on a separate floor, offering specialized halitosis treatment in an environment that respects patient privacy. The clinic operates on a two-shift system (morning and afternoon) primarily on weekdays and Saturdays.
